“효율적인 프로그래밍을 위한 고랭 언어 컴퓨터 프로그래밍 전략”

고랭 언어 소개

고랭(Golang)은 구글에서 개발한 프로그래밍 언어로, 간결하면서도 효율적인 코드 작성을 지원합니다. C/C++과 같은 저수준 언어의 빠른 속도와 자바와 같은 고수준 언어의 편리함을 모두 갖추고 있습니다. 특히 병행성(Concurrency)을 강조하며 동시에 여러 작업을 처리하는데 뛰어난 성능을 보여주며 대규모 시스템에 적합합니다.

고랭은 정적 타입 체계를 사용하면서도 컴파일 속도가 빠르고 가비지 컬렉션 기능을 제공하여 메모리 관리를 효율적으로 수행합니다. 또한 풍부한 표준 라이브러리를 갖고 있어 다양한 응용 프로그램을 개발하기에 용이합니다. 또한 고루틴(Goroutines) 기능은 간단하게 동시성 프로그래밍을 할 수 있도록 도와줍니다.

고랭은 크로스 플랫폼을 지원하므로 다양한 운영체제에서 사용할 수 있으며, 빠른 개발 주기와 확장성이 뛰어나기 때문에 현재 많은 기업에서 선호하는 언어 중 하나입니다. 객체지향 언어의 장점과 절차지향 언어의 간결함을 결합한 고랭은 빠르게 성장하고 있는 언어로, 앞으로 더 많은 사람들이 관심을 갖게 될 것으로 기대됩니다.

효율적인 프로그래밍 전략

효율적인 프로그래밍은 개발자들에게 필수적인 스킬입니다. 코드의 품질과 성능을 향상시키는데 중요한 역할을 합니다. 효율적인 프로그래밍 전략은 코드의 가독성과 유지보수성을 높이는 것뿐만 아니라 실행 시간을 최적화하여 빠른 속도로 작동되도록 하는 것을 목표로 합니다.

첫째, 코드를 작성하기 전에 문제를 명확히 이해하는 것이 중요합니다. 문제를 분석하고 요구사항을 명확하게 정의함으로써 효율적인 코드를 작성할 수 있습니다.

둘째, 적절한 자료구조와 알고리즘을 선택하는 것도 중요합니다. 문제의 특성에 맞는 자료구조와 알고리즘을 선택하면 실행 시간을 효율적으로 관리할 수 있습니다.

셋째, 코드의 재사용성을 높이기 위해 함수와 모듈화를 적극적으로 활용해야 합니다. 유지보수가 쉬운 코드는 효율적인 코드입니다.

넷째, 코드를 작성한 후에는 테스트와 리팩토링을 통해 코드의 품질을 향상시켜야 합니다. 버그를 미리 발견하고 코드를 개선함으로써 더욱 효율적인 프로그래밍을 할 수 있습니다.

효율적인 프로그래밍은 개발자들에게 역량을 키우고 더 나은 코드를 작성할 수 있는 기회를 제공합니다. 업무 효율성을 높이고 더 나은 소프트웨어를 개발하기 위해 지속적으로 학습하고 발전해야 합니다.

컴퓨터 프로그래밍 기초

컴퓨터 프로그래밍 기초에 대해 알아보겠습니다. 프로그래밍은 현대 사회에서 필수적인 기술로, 컴퓨터 언어를 사용하여 컴퓨터에 명령을 내리는 과정을 말합니다. 프로그래밍을 배우면 문제 해결 능력이 향상되고 창의적으로 생각할 수 있는 능력도 길러집니다.

컴퓨터 프로그래밍은 많은 분야에서 활용되며, 웹 개발, 앱 개발, 데이터 분석, 인공지능 등 여러 분야에서 프로그래밍 스킬이 요구됩니다. 프로그래밍 언어는 다양한데, 파이썬, 자바스크립트, 자바, C++ 등이 널리 사용됩니다.

프로그래밍을 배우는 가장 좋은 방법은 많은 연습과 도전입니다. 간단한 문제부터 시작해서 점차 어려워지는 문제를 해결해보며 실력을 키워나가는 것이 중요합니다. 컴퓨터 프로그래밍은 논리적 사고와 문제 해결능력을 기르는 데 큰 도움이 됩니다. 이를 통해 미래의 기술 발전에도 기여할 수 있을 것입니다.

고랭으로의 전환가능성

오늘은 고랭에서의 전환 가능성에 대해 알아보겠습니다. 고랭은 구글이 개발한 오픈소스 프로그래밍 언어로, 뛰어난 성능과 생산성으로 많은 개발자들에게 사랑을 받고 있습니다. 고랭은 간결하고 빠른 컴파일 속도로 유명하며, 병행성을 강조하여 복잡한 시스템을 쉽게 구축할 수 있습니다.

고랭은 동시성을 지원하기 때문에 대규모 시스템에서도 뛰어난 성능을 발휘합니다. 또한 함수형 프로그래밍 스타일을 채택하여 코드의 안정성과 재사용성을 높여줍니다. 이러한 특징으로 인해 고랭은 클라우드 환경이나 분산 시스템에서 활용되는데, 특히 마이크로서비스 아키텍처에 잘 맞습니다.

고랭을 익히면서 함수형 프로그래밍에 대한 깊은 이해를 얻을 수 있고, 동시성 프로그래밍에 대한 경험을 쌓을 수 있습니다. 또한 고랭은 간결하고 가독성이 높아 유지보수도 용이하며, 오류가 적은 안정적인 시스템을 구축할 수 있습니다. 따라서 고랭으로의 전환은 새로운 기회와 가능성을 열어줄 것입니다. 도전해보세요!

Leave a Comment